Earful: Listen to Websites 4+

Text to Speech for Safari

Michael Rebello

    • 3.9 • 8 Ratings
    • Free
    • Offers In-App Purchases

iPhone Screenshots


Earful enables you to listen to any web article by adding a "Play" button in the corner of your Safari browser.

- Adjust the rate/speed of speech.
- Choose between many voices in a variety of locales.
- Reposition the play button to wherever works best for you.
- Configure which websites Earful should not appear on.
- There are no fees, no ads, and no time limits. Earful is free and it always will be.

The current market is saturated with text-to-speech apps that cost upwards of $150/year to use, are plastered with ads, or have time limits. We created Earful as a free alternative for anyone to use text-to-speech to listen to articles right within their browser. Whether you’re a student that processes better with auditory senses, a mom trying to “read” the latest article on the New York Times in the middle of the night while rocking a baby to sleep, or a business person keeping an eye on the latest trends - Earful is here to help.

Earful works best with articles, and it's not optimized for reading other websites like stores, search engines, etc. On-device accessibility features are best suited for those purposes.

What’s New

Version 0.3.2

- Improves text-to-speech on various websites

Ratings and Reviews

3.9 out of 5
8 Ratings

8 Ratings

Lily0364 ,

best safari tts extension i’ve found

best safari tts extension i’ve found, also allows me to play this alongside other media, but i’d like to be able to adjust the volume relative to the media being played alongside

John Goodin ,

Is long pressing on the button supported in iOS?

I’ve got a suggestion. Is it possible to have the button support long pressing? It’s my idea long pressing for say 8 seconds would open a simple dialog to have Earful hidden on a site.

Long press and you’re asked if you want the current site hidden. If you say yes it’s then added to the listing of excluded sites. You’re asked to reload the current page. Three simple steps and the page is excluded.

If that’s not possible maybe be able to launch the app itself from inside of Safari? You would first manually have to copy the url from Safari.

Also I would like to be able to edit or remove sites from the exclusion list. Say I misspelled the site name or pasting it in included errors.

Would like to be able to export the exclusion list to be able to share them with others.

Developer Response ,

Thank you for your feedback! We've added a feature to disable Earful on specific sites, and have automatically disabled it on some common streaming websites.

thatcjkid ,


I would suggest actually having not just a button with only play and pause, but have it where you can click rewind and forward in increments. The instructions currently say if you want to start at a specific place, select the text and then push play. I paused it and selected text because I wanted to skip the text it was reading. When I pushed play after selecting the text, it didn’t read the selected text. It continued where it was currently reading. I refreshed the page, selected the text I wanted it to start at. It started reading from the beginning.

App Privacy

The developer, Michael Rebello, indicated that the app’s privacy practices may include handling of data as described below. For more information, see the developer’s privacy policy.

Data Not Linked to You

The following data may be collected but it is not linked to your identity:

  • Usage Data

Privacy practices may vary, for example, based on the features you use or your age. Learn More

You Might Also Like